Increased physical activity can help a lot both for gestational Diabetes as well as for diabetes.Why? because physical activity will burn more calories and helps body cells to absorb glucose effectively than normal with low physical activity.

Yes. Cane sugar (sucrose) should be easily digestible as it is composed of 50% glucose and 50% fructose. The glucose aids digestion of the fructose. As always, other factors beyond your fructose malabsorption may influence your ability to digest sucrose.
